Minister KTR Alerts Resident Commissioner about Telugu Students Stranded in Himachal

Hyderabad: The torrential rains in Himachal Pradesh have created a dire situation, affecting the tourist regions. Due to the severe flooding, some Telugu students are stranded in Kullu and Manali. The distressed parents of these students reached out for help, and the Minister of Telangana IT and Industries, KTR, has been informed about the situation.

In response to the distress call, KTR took to Twitter to share the information and assured that necessary actions are being taken. He mentioned that he has alerted the Resident Commissioner in New Delhi to assist the stranded students. Additionally, he provided contact information for those who may need assistance, urging them to reach out to @TS_Bhavan.
